Smt Renu Kumari ====================================================== CORAM: HONOURABLE MR. JUSTICE PRAKASH CHANDRA JAISWAL ORAL ORDER 18-01-2019 Heard learned counsel for the petitioner and learned APP for the State.

The petitioner seeks bail in Adhoura P.S. Case No. 46 of 2018 registered under Section 307 of the Indian Penal Code and Section 27 of the Arms Act.

Some unknown miscreants resorted firing on the son of the informant on way to school and during the course of investigation after going through the call details it has come that the petitioner and another accused persons were in touch with the main accused, namely, Hari Yadav.

It is submitted by learned counsel for the petitioner that the no such occurrence as alleged ever took place. The petitioner has committed no offence. He has no concern with the aforesaid

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.79293 of 2018(2) dt.18-01-2019 2/2 occurrence. He has been falsely implicated in this case. The petitioner is neither named in the F.I.R. nor he was apprehended on the spot. No test identification parade was conducted. He has no concern with the accused Hari Yadav. Similarly situated coaccused, namely, Lalita Yadav has been enlarged on bail by a co-ordinate bench of this Court vide order dated 15.01.2019 passed in Cr. Misc. No. 79649 of 2018. The petitioner has been languishing in custody since 06.11.2018.

Considering the facts aforesaid, the above named petitioner is directed to be enlarged on bail on furnishing bail bond of Rs. 10,000/- (Rupees Ten Thousand) with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of the learned Judicial Magistrate 1st Class, Kaimur, Bhabua in connection with Adhoura P.S. Case No.46 of 2018, G.R. No.1861/18. (Prakash Chandra Jaiswal, J) Trivedi/- U T
